The sixth night of Kwanzaa will be celebrated Dec. 31 from 1 to 4 p.m. at the New Africa House Theater Room, 181 Infirmary Way, UMass. The event is sponsored by the Black Business Association of Amherst Area. The keynote presentation by Professor Amilcar Shabazz will be on “The Creative Economy and the Gift of Black Folx.”

While some homes in town have Little Libraries in the front yard, Orchard Valley boasts a jigsaw puzzle library on Glendale Road. I dropped off some puzzles in the box that has glass doors and a wooden latch. I took a puzzle. When I finish, I will trade it in for another. Puzzles are a great thing to do on cold winter evenings.
